Hi,what is minimal recommended memory reservation for domain0? It won't run any services apart from sshd and xend and will provide files from /home (ext3) to other domains as their block devices. Machine is 466MHz Celeron with 256MB of RAM, UDMA/33 IDE interface, and will run about 5 other domains, so less is more ;-).Boot it with 64MB and then use the balloon driver to crank it down a bit. Give it a swap file to be on the safe side. Just a small question - if I use `xm balloon Domain-0 64`, `xm info` reports correct amount of memory as free, but `free` says that domain0 has still $original_memory_size total, but used memory grows up, is it correct?
